ICT OFFICER

Amref Health Africa was founded in 1957 and has since grown to become the largest
African-based international health development organisation; currently implementing
more than 180 programs, reaching more than 40 million people across 35 African
countries; and a staff complement of over 2,000. Headquartered in Nairobi, Kenya,
Amref Health Africa has offices in ten countries in Africa – Burkina Faso, Ethiopia,
Guinea (Conakry), Kenya, Malawi, Senegal, South Sudan Tanzania, Uganda and Zambia.
An additional eleven advocacy and fundraising are located in Europe and North
America.

MAIN PURPOSE OF THE JOB

To initiate and maintain dynamic information systems that caters for AMREF Flying
Doctor’s information technology needs and ensure use of appropriate information
technology in line with the AMREF Flying Doctors ICT strategy.

PRINCIPAL RESPONSIBILITIES

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

MAIN TASKS

Network Administration Services

Regular evaluation of current computer hardware/software in order to provide a timely


replacement schedule or upgrade;

Testing new programs before user installation and implantation; and

Setting up and maintaining all internet and Microsoft Exchange E-mail accounts and
server configurations.

Technical Support and Capacity Building

Receiving (telephone, e-mail, delegation, monitoring tools, visit) and diagnosing issues
from all staff for appropriate solutions;

Providing relevant information about the system to enable resource access;

Guiding users systematically to trouble shoot systems and offering immediate and
alternative solution to issues;

Empowering users by sending system tips and guidance instruction;

Logging user issue for escalation either to the Network and Infrastructure Manager or
product/service supplier;

Facilitating IT training to all AMREF Flying Doctors staff and offices for effective
utilization of AMREF Flying Doctors core systems and new products;

Providing technical support and trouble-shooting for installed servers, including


implementation of disaster recovery plans and prepare standard procedures for
monitoring servers, and ensure that they are fully operational.

System & Information Security

Providing support in setting up the infrastructure for virtualization and private cloud
basics;

Administering E-policy McAfee antivirus and client update and configuration;


Publishing of internal resource for external access like in magic, outlook anywhere &
web access and

Patching application with current security updates and hot fixes.

System analysis, development, implementation and maintenance

Virtual servers design, implementation and maintenance;

Performing infrastructure/software design development to ensure compatibility and


operationally with AMREF Flying Doctor’s LAN and WAN requirements;

Participating in the definition, designing, testing and implementation of new Information


Technology (IT) hardware and software standards for AMREF Flying Doctors based on
user requirements and in accordance with the strategy and direction. Resolve any
Hardware (PCs, Routers, switches, Servers & UCS Configuration related problems; and

Testing and configuring all new equipment, particularly notebooks, desktops and
servers to ensure compatibility with AMREF Flying Doctors requirements and standards.

Inventory management & Maintenance

Maintaining software and hardware inventory;

Ensuring secure custody of equipment within AMREF Flying Doctors;

Supervising equipment preventive maintenance and carry out a regular evaluation of


current hardware/software in order to provide a timely replacement schedule or
upgrade.

Information Management

Coordinating the production of technical instruction materials for technical and user
support and ensure the documentations are kept up to date.

ANY OTHER TASKS

Advisory on procurement of technical equipment and related tasks.
